Practical Designer Notes
Before using the Printable First Day of Freshman Year PNG in any project, I recommend testing it on scrap fabric first. This will help you understand how the design behaves on different materials and whether adjustments are needed. Pay close attention to the stitch density and ensure that the design is large enough for your intended project.
Check the thread color contrast against the fabric background to avoid issues with visibility. If the design is going to be used on dark fabrics, consider using a lighter thread color or adjusting the design itself. Also, make sure to review the file format and compatibility with your embroidery machine before proceeding.
For commercial projects, confirm the licensing terms to ensure that the Printable First Day of Freshman Year PNG can be used without restrictions. If you’re selling finished products, always include a clear disclaimer about the design’s usage rights. This helps protect both you and your customers.
Finally, don’t underestimate the power of a printable mockup. Using the design in a mockup can give you a better idea of how it will look on different items and help you make informed decisions about its placement and sizing.
